This is my first post here. I would like to ask you, if I keep the steam input same and run the TG at 49 Hz frequency, can I generate more power than I have generated in case of 50 Hz operation?
 
Storm Rider,

It's not possible to run a turbine-generator set in parallel with (<b>synchronized</b> to) other generators at a frequency or speed that is different from the other machines.

If you're referring to a machine that is isolated from others, operating in "island mode, then yes, theoretically it would be possible--except that all the induction motors being powered by the turbine-generator set would be operating at less than 98% of rated speed and would likely be drawing more current (power) than rated so your extra power would be consumed by the motors operating at less than rated speed.
